Output 123f607bb321261a5622d7dc33f1cf634bf0b770d51cade48a07dc92523840e5: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dfedc3c42cdbb63a00034339fcf8a4118043c78 OP_EQUAL
address
38oRGKRMUCTa9pvJ1XJkwQYwdaN7Fi55DM
transaction
123f607bb321261a5622d7dc33f1cf634bf0b770d51cade48a07dc92523840e5
spent
true